Course Overview

This customized AWS training provides comprehensive coverage of core AWS infrastructure and cloud services, including IAM, EC2, EBS, EFS, VPC, Elastic Load Balancing, Auto Scaling, RDS, Route 53, S3, CloudFront, containers, serverless services, and AWS monitoring capabilities. The curriculum covers both foundational concepts and detailed configuration areas across compute, storage, networking, databases, content delivery, containers, and serverless technologies.

The training is designed around theory discussions and hands-on practical exercises. The source emphasizes active participation in labs and discussions and assumes familiarity with AWS, operating systems, Linux commands, web servers, programming, and relational databases.

Pre-requisites

  • Technical Essentials training or at least one year of AWS experience as a user or developer
  • Programming experience in Java, .NET, PHP, Node.js, Python, or similar technologies
  • Familiarity with web servers such as Apache, Tomcat, or IIS
  • Basic operating-system concepts, Linux commands, VI/VIM/NANO editing, and RDBMS concepts
  • Basic knowledge of remote database connectivity, DDL, and DML
